Centrioles are best described as

Explanation:
Centrioles are slender cylindrical structures made of microtubules arranged in a characteristic ninefold pattern, forming part of the centrosome that organizes the spindle apparatus during cell division. This microtubule-based composition is what defines them as slender shaped microtubules. They aren’t genetic material like DNA, not membrane clusters of phospholipids, and not enzyme complexes that produce ATP (that role is linked to mitochondria). Their microtubule structure and role in organizing spindle fibers during division best fit the description as slender shaped microtubules.
